Various Knowledge Use Grows Strongly Amongst Buyers, Due to AI


(Zakharchuk/Shutterstock)

Funding advisors are increasing their use of other knowledge because of generative AI and the aggressive benefits they plan to acquire by it, based on the newest report on different knowledge from Lowenstein Sandler.

Various knowledge is the funding enviornment refers to something that doesn’t seem in firm filings, press releases, analyst studies, and different conventional sources. Buyers wish to different knowledge like firm bank card transactions, geolocation, cellular system knowledge, and social media to be able to achieve a probably profitable sign that may be exploited for aggressive benefit.

Lowenstein Sandler is a legislation agency that has been surveying funding advisors in hedge funds, non-public fairness corporations, and enterprise capital funds about their use of other knowledge since 2019. The corporate detected a surge in using different knowledge in 2023, when the variety of individuals in its survey affirming using different knowledge doubled from the earlier yr, going from 31% to 62%.

The corporate lately shipped its 2024 report, titled “Various Knowledge Poised for Extra Progress within the Age of AI,” and the pattern has continued. Sixty-seven p.c of the 103 individuals surveyed by Lowenstein Sandler (composed of 95% non-public fairness corporations, 2% hedge funds, and three% enterprise capital corporations) affirmed that they use different knowledge. The p.c of individuals saying they’re making “important use of other knowledge” elevated from 43% in 2023 to 54% in 2024, whereas these making reasonable use declined 9%.

What’s extra, 94% of present different knowledge customers say they’re rising their budgets for the information sort, whereas 87% say their agency now has a proper coverage round its use (and 68% have adopted insurance policies about utilizing different knowledge with AI). These knowledge factors signifies different knowledge has achieved a foothold in these corporations.

The emergence of generative AI is taking part in a job within the growth of other knowledge. In accordance with the report, 61% of survey respondents say they use AI for funding analysis, portfolio optimization, or buying and selling, whereas 58% say they use it for summarizing analysis and supplies. Amongst respondents already utilizing AI for funding and buying and selling functions, 85% say they’re going to broaden their use of it within the subsequent yr. Amongst these not utilizing AI, 43% plan to undertake it for subsequent yr, the report says.

“Various knowledge is now not novel, however the mixture with AI creates the chance for unique insights at a scale and velocity that was beforehand unattainable,” says Scott H. Moss co-chair of the funding administration group at Lowenstein Sandler. “Now we have entered a brand new period of funding that shall be formed largely by know-how’s exploitation of knowledge.”

Various knowledge can come from a variety of sources. The sources that noticed the most important proportion level will increase from earlier surveys got here from cloud platforms (17%), app utilization (17%), biometric knowledge (16%), and Internet scraping (20%), the corporate says.

Funding corporations are utilizing their different knowledge for a wide range of use instances. The highest three use instances had been: growing distinctive funding methods, producing larger returns whereas managing danger, and understanding evolving buyer buy behaviors, based on the report.

Survey respondents say they acquire their different knowledge comes from a wide range of  sources, the highest three being cloud platforms, client transactions, and app utilization. Artificial knowledge (which wasn’t an choice in 2024) was quantity 4 on the listing, adopted by social media, with Fb, Instagram, and X being the main sources.

Whereas different knowledge can generate alpha, it doesn’t come with out dangers. The highest concern that corporations have with regards to different knowledge are knowledge possession and privateness points, cited by 36% of survey respondents. There was a three-way tie for second place at 33%, shared by knowledge safety/breach, danger of buying materials private info, and elevated compliance burdens, the survey exhibits.

Among the many one-third of corporations not utilizing different knowledge, there have been a number of causes for why they don’t use it. Locked in a four-way tie at 35% had been lack of belief within the high quality of the information, too costly, regulatory/compliance danger, and technical difficulties working with the information.
